处理csv处理 csv 使用 clap 使用derive方式,features用来调整一个项目的不同的功能内容。 文档 目标考虑: rcli csv -i input.csv -o output.json --header -d ',' clap是rust的命令行解析器 几个宏介绍:文档地址 arg: 可以获取终端输入的字符串参数; command:定义对应的命令; wxvirus2024年4月20日rustcli大约 6 分钟
问题积累问题积累 impl Into> 作为函数参数类型,比 Option 好在哪 在Rust语言中,impl Into>作为函数参数类型,意味着函数可以接受任何能够转换为Option的类型。这种用法提供了更大的灵活性和泛用性,因为实现了Into>的类型不仅限于Option本身,还包括其他可以转换为Option的类型。 例如,如果你有一个函数,其参数类型为Optiowxvirus2024年4月20日rustquestioninterview大约 2 分钟
rust常用工具常用工具 pre-commit 安装成功后运行pre-commit install cargo deny " 用于检查依赖的安全性" typos " 拼写检查工具" git cliff " 生产一个changelog的工具" nextest " rust 的增强测试工具" cargo-generate 问题 如果遇到一个 可能是你的git设置了proxy 这wxvirus2024年3月23日rusttool大约 2 分钟